Jibison is the new salsa sensation at Garufa

For the past few weeks, Saturday is Salsa Night at Garufa cocktail lounge with the new musical combo, Jibison, with popular local vocalist Anna Para.

The ensemble was put together by musician at heart Nino Kelly, famous for his baby back ribs at the end of main-street. The band played on his open air terrace for a while as Jibison 4, with just four musicians, before it was discovered by David Gross Garcia the manager of Garufa Cigar & Cocktail Lounge who invited them to play at the club.

Kelly who is the band’s bongo player reports that the original band members brought some of their friends along and that is how the ensemble grew to six and even seven, on special occasions. Piano man Lucho Argote, the band’s musical director is currently working to expand the band’s repertory to play contemporary Latin rock/pop favorites by Juanes, and Maná for example, in addition to the band’s excellent Salsa, Merenge, Bachata and Cuban style Son Montuno hits.

Jibison recently released its first single recording which is doing very well on the air, and is played often by the local radio DJs.
